Research shows that eating the same meal at different times of day – or even with a different intention – can have a very different impact on your blood sugar and overall health. Today’s episode features excerpts from interviews with two female nutritional and metabolic experts, Dr. Casey Means and Dr. Mindy Pelz. Both share the science and strategies behind meal composition, meal timing, and mindful eating practices.
